St. Andrew's Church finally went to Bartholomew

Today, the law on the transfer of St. Andrew’s Church to the Ecumenical Patriarchate for use came into force, a PolitNavigator correspondent reports. Kyiv approved the bribe to Bartholomew

On the second attempt, the Verkhovna Rada approved the transfer of St. Andrew's Church of Kyiv to the subordination of the Patriarchate of Constantinople. 237 deputies voted for the corresponding decision at today’s meeting, a PolitNavigator correspondent reports. It is noteworthy that they had to vote twice - the first time they managed to collect only 216 votes in support.
